From the rear cover: "Charles Stewart Parnell, the squire of Avondale who became the "Uncrowned King of Ireland' is one of the most enigmatic personalities in Irish history. The documents in this illustrated biography recall various aspects of his complex personality, his private life and his political career. They were penned by various players in the Parnell drama, including his mistress, Katherine O'Shea, Archbishop Croke of Cashel, the Fenian Michael Davitt, and the forger Richard Pigott." 8.5" wide by 11.25" tall. From upper cover flap: The National Library of Ireland is a major source for the study of the Irish Famine. Its collections include the newspapers, the parliamentary debates, and the various official reports published at the time. The Department of Manuscripts holds the records of many of the great landed estates, which provide primary evidence on the landlords' role in the crisis. The Library's extensive collection of prints and drawings enables us to visualise conditions at the time, and to empathise with our ancestors in their travails. To give as broad an understanding as possible of this vast and complex subject, the book also includes documents and illustrations from a number of other repositories. They include the National Archives, the Department of Irish Folklore at University College Dublin, Dublin Diocesan Archives, Birmingham Library Services, the British Library, the National Library of Scotland, the McKinney Library in Albany, U.S.A., and the National Archives of Canada.
